Understanding Astigmatism and Its Effects on Vision



Understanding Astigmatism and its Impacts on Vision:

If you have astigmatism, your vision may be fuzzy or distorted because of the uneven shape of your cornea. Astigmatism takes place when the cornea is not perfectly round, yet rather has a more oblong shape. This triggers light to be refracted erratically, leading to fuzzy or distorted vision.

Astigmatism can likewise create problems with deepness perception and might make it challenging to see fine details.

The good news is, LASIK surgical procedure can aid remedy astigmatism by improving the cornea. During the treatment, a laser is used to get rid of small amounts of cells from the cornea, allowing it to come to be much more round fit. This aids to enhance the method light is concentrated onto the retina, leading to more clear vision and reduced astigmatism.

The LASIK Procedure: Improving the Cornea



By carefully altering the shape of the eye's surface, vision abnormalities can be properly attended to via a prominent procedure called LASIK. During the LASIK procedure, a specialized laser is utilized to improve the cornea, the clear front surface area of the eye. This enables light to properly concentrate on the retina, leading to clearer vision.

Here are the vital actions associated with the LASIK treatment:

- The surgeon creates a thin flap on the cornea making use of a microkeratome or femtosecond laser.
- The flap is raised to reveal the underlying corneal cells.
- The excimer laser is then made use of to precisely eliminate cells from the cornea, reshaping it to remedy the astigmatism.
- The flap is carefully repositioned, functioning as a natural plaster that promotes fast healing.




LASIK is a quick and pain-free treatment that has actually helped countless individuals achieve improved vision and freedom from glasses or get in touch with lenses.
